The Handmaid’s Tale (1990) – Natasha Richardson Nude, Victoria Tennant Nude Scene Video
3511Natasha Richardson in nude scene from The Handmaid’s Tale which was released in 1990. She shows us her tits in sex scene. Also Victoria Tennant naked in The Handmaid’s Tale. We can see sex scene with her. So Victoria Tennant is not shy and she demonstrating her boobs.